As an outsider, this was my first exposure to the hornet's nest created by publication in 1977 of Human Sexuality: New Directions in American Catholic Thought (Paulist Press). The present volume is an acceptance of the invitation to "serious criticism" and "scholarly dialogue" extended in the earlier book. "The task of the contributors to the present volume is to argue the views advanced in Human Sexuality in a way that critics to date have not done." - Introduction. 249 pp. Size: 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
